Site work and new construction of a municipal facility in Holly Springs, Georgia. Completed plans call for the construction of a 6,738-square-foot, one-story above grade municipal facility; and for site work for a municipal facility.
**As of October 8, 2025, the project was awarded to Place Services Inc., with an awarded amount of $5,144,473** Reference Number 0000394759 The Cherokee County Board of Commissioners Purchasing Department (County) is requesting competitive sealed Proposals in support of the Cherokee County Community Services Agency in seeking General Contractor services for construction of an administrative and operations facility to support the current and future needs of the Cherokee Area Transit Service (CATS). The scope includes construction of a new CATS facility designed to provide bus parking, service, and administrative offices for the Cherokee County Transit Service. The facility will be located on roughly 6.5 acres on the southwest corner of Univeter Road and Pinecrest Road in Cherokee County GA. The new facility will be approximately 6,738 square feet. It will include, but is not limited to, offices, reception area, conference room, training room/garage, dispatch, kitchenette and breakroom, restrooms and associated mechanical, IT, janitorial and storages spaces, meeting the specifications and as described herein. Details are on the Designated Website with posted plans and specifications The Federal Transit Administration is providing financial assistance for this project. Cherokee County has established a Race Neutral Program weighted DBE Utilization Goal of 6.08%. There is no Contract Specific Goal for this Project. See FTA Clauses for additional detail regarding the DBE program. Anticipated federal, and state permits required for the project have been obtained. Conditional building permit approval has been received from Cherokee County. The monument sign permit is in process with Cherokee County. Contractor to file for Fire Prevention Permit through Cherokee County. Contractor will remain responsible to pull the permits. No fees will be charged for any County issued permits. County has set aside 365 calendar days from NTP for material completion. All property, rights of way, and easements have been obtained. There will be a mandatory meeting to review the requirements and site work completed to date. The meeting will be held at the proposed work site and will include walking the area.
